Protein similarity

Research project Protein similarity

Determining similarity between proteins in biophysical space.

We are exploring how we can use our approaches to improve the detection of protein function and homology in their 'biophysical' instead of their sequence space.

Resources

Rigapollo (Software tool, In-house)

ST resource  Rigapollo
Rigapollo is an SVM-dependent pairwise HMM tool for protein pairwise alignments.
